CPU - AMD Ryzen 5 9600X
CPU (alternatywa) - AMD Ryzen 5 7600X
Chłodzenie CPU - 360mm AIO Water Cooler RGB
GPU - Intel ARC B580
GPU (alternatywa) - Nvidia Geforce RTX 3060
Płyta główna - B850 ATX Motherboard + Wifi 7
RAM - 32gb DDR5 6000mhz CL28
Pamięć - 1TB M.2 SSD PCIe Gen 4 SSD
Obudowa - ATX, Wood, Dual Chamber, Dual Glass, PC Case
Zasilacz - 650W 80+ Bronze Semi Modular Power Supply
Monitor - 1920x1080 400Hz IPS Gaming Monitor

Step 2: GPU Debate – AMD Radeon RX 7600 vs NVIDIA RTX 3060
The graphics card is where most of your budget will go, and for esports gaming at 1080p, both the AMD Radeon RX 7600 and NVIDIA RTX 3060 are excellent choices. The RX 7600 offers great performance at a more affordable price point, while the RTX 3060 provides ray tracing support if you’re into that. Both GPUs can handle Fortnite, Valorant, and other esports titles smoothly at high settings.

Step 4: Power Supply – 650W 80+ Bronze Semi Modular
A reliable power supply is essential for stable operation. The 650W 80+ Bronze semi-modular PSU in your build provides enough wattage to handle the Ryzen 5 9600X and RX 7600 (or RTX 3060) without issues. It’s also built to last, making it a worthwhile investment for your esports PC.
Step 5: Storage – 1TB M.2 PCIe 4.0 SSD
With the rise of large game files and streaming needs, fast storage is a must. The 1TB M.2 PCIe 4.0 SSD in your build ensures quick load times and seamless multitasking. Whether you’re loading Valorant or streaming your gameplay, this SSD will keep things running smoothly.
Step 6: RAM – 32GB DDR5 6000MHz CL28
For an esports PC, having plenty of fast RAM is a game-changer. The included 32GB DDR5 6000MHz RAM ensures that your build can handle not just gaming but also multitasking like streaming, editing, or running multiple applications simultaneously.
